Just sharing my collection that I have accumalated over the past 8 years since I got my first watch.
Casio F91W - Received this as a gift recently. As someone who isn't a big fan of G Shocks to my surprise ive really been enoying wearing this specificially at the gym the fact that its really thin and all black really makes it feel quite seemless while using it to workout.
Hamilton Khaki Field Auto 38 - This is the second watch that I purchased myself and the first that I truly spent alot of time researching and thinking about how it would fit into my collection. It serves as my dedicated Nato strap watch as I really enjoy wearing nato's. Field watches are probably my second favourite category right after dress.
Omega SMP 2220.80.00 - The first watch that probably started it all. I was lucky enough to get an opportunity to acquire this watch through a family member at a great price back then I was quite young probably around 14-15 and this was the first time I had saved up enough to buy something so expensive I was always somewhat aware of most watches and definitely quite aware of the bond watches as I used to admire them on Daniel Craigs wrist in the movies so when this casino royale ref came up it almost felt unreal that I was able to get it at that age and time.
Omega Speedmaster Cal 1861 - This was bought not too long ago I believe in 2023. This was a watch that I always liked but never considered due to the size however I was unsuccesfully looking for Grand Seiko's locally as Imo it is one of the most interesting brands for me currently and got a chance to try on the speedy at a local boutique and immediately felt like getting it as the size truly fits much better then expected. I still beleive its slightly on the larger size but since it is a sports watch im fine with it but this is probably the largest i would go.
JLC Reverso - My most recent acquisiton that I didnt have the stomach to purchase so I never really thought about owning it but I had the budget for a vacation saved up for a few years now and I havent really gone anywhere so now that im coming up on a major event in my life and getting married this year I thought why not .A "grail" watch for me since the first time i found out about it I could talk about the marketing material regarding history and JLC's importance in watchmaking but truly I coudlnt care as purely from a design perspective this is the watch that best suits me.
King Seiko 4502-7000 - A watch I came to know due to my interest in Grand Seiko's. I randomly stumbled upon the history of Seiko and its sub brands King & Grand Seiko where I watched many videos and read many articles regarding Seiko's accomplishment and the competition between the 2 factories producing KS & GS which I really enjoyed which led me to the archives of models produced where I really liked pretty much all of vintage KS as compared to GS which led me to this tastefully sized vintage KS with what I beleive has a really cool case and movement. I sometimes want to collect all of the vintage peices but trying to remain somewhat sane.
Cartier Tanks Solo/Must - So I kind of cheated this actually isnt my watch I just put it in the picture to visualise somewhat what my complete collection will look like for the next few years atleast. I am getting a Tank Must black dial as a gift on my wedding so kind of made sense to have this here to complete the picture.
Raymond Weil 2835 - Finally the RW tradition this was my first "Luxury watch" that apparantly as per my mother was gifted to my father the same year I was born by my Grandfather. I find the watch to be really elegant with the textured dial, sub seconds & the gold plated case. Being my first watch I had used this as a beater pretty much every single day for quite some time and now is not worn frequently but mostly on special occassions.
Thats it my 8 watch collection for a while hopefully some of these peices I plan to keep forever and never replacing but some I do at times think about replacing I am going to do a 1 in out out policy for the future as to not exceed 8 watches.
